Floor drain cleaning


floor drain serviceLots of houses have floor drains in their basements, utility room, garages and outdoor patios to keep excess water from flooding and triggering damage. Due to the fact that basements are the bottom-most parts of homes, floor drains are especially common in them, because rain and drain water can so quickly circulation down and flood basements. Like drains you may find in your sink or bath tub, floor drains are geared up with traps below. These traps should be kept loaded with water to prevent drain gases and odors from leaving into the space.

The most common issue with flooring drains is simply that they or the traps can become obstructed with dirt and particles. Sump pump maintenance


Sump pumps are another common draining pipes system discovered in basements. They keep ground water from flooding the home by diverting it into neighboring storm drains, wells or ponds. If you have a sump pump that isn't working correctly, it could cause flooding and damage, specifically after heavy rainfall. Basement plumbing tips


Correctly maintaining your basement floor drain and sump pump will make them less most likely to require repair. Here are a number of upkeep tips:

Keep your trap seal full: Because your basement flooring drain doesn't get a lot of usage, it's crucial to by hand keep the trap seal below it loaded with water. If the trap seal isn't really complete, it might enable sewer gases to support into your basement. So what should you do? Just put a pail of thin down the drain every so often.
Evaluate your sump pump frequently: You can use the very same approach to test your sump pump before the rainy season begins. Put a bucket of water into the sump pit - the mechanism ought to switch on, pump the water away and turn off.
